Understanding Myopia: Reasons and Symptoms
Myopia, frequently referred to as nearsightedness, is an expanding issue for parents today. It happens when the eyeball is as well lengthy or the cornea is too bent, creating far-off objects to show up blurry.
You could notice your child scrunching up your eyes, resting too near to the television, or whining concerning problem seeing the board in school. Various other signs include headaches and eye stress, particularly after extended display time or reading.
Genetics can play a substantial role; if you or your companion are myopic, your child goes to a greater risk. Ecological variables, such as limited exterior time, likewise contribute to Myopia's advancement.

Treatment Options: What Parents Ought To Take into consideration
As you look for to manage your child's Myopia, comprehending the numerous therapy options readily available is crucial.
Begin by speaking to your ophthalmologist about rehabilitative lenses, such as glasses or contact lenses, which can enhance your kid's vision. You might likewise check out unique contact lenses developed to slow Myopia development, like orthokeratology lenses.
Additionally, atropine eye declines have actually shown assurance in lowering Myopia innovation. Consider behavior techniques also; enhancing outside time and limiting display direct exposure can benefit eye health.
